Jean‐François Arrighi is a scholar working on Plant Science, Immunology and Agronomy and Crop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Jean‐François Arrighi has authored 56 papers receiving a total of 3.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 27 papers in Plant Science, 20 papers in Immunology and 16 papers in Agronomy and Crop Science. Recurrent topics in Jean‐François Arrighi’s work include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(23 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(20 papers) and Agronomic Practices and Intercropping Systems (16 papers). Jean‐François Arrighi is often cited by papers focused on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(23 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(20 papers) and Agronomic Practices and Intercropping Systems (16 papers). Jean‐François Arrighi coll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and United States. Jean‐François Arrighi's co-authors include Conrad Hauser, Vincent Kindler, Vincent Piguet, Michela Rebsamen, F Rousset, Laurent Nussaume, Marjorie Pion, Vincent Bayle, Eduardo Garcia and Serge Chiarenza and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, The Journal of Experimental Medicine and Blood.
